If you have to use the Communications Toolbox, you will also need a script to connect to SVPAL. The Communications Toolbox is system software included with System 7 and above, and it can be added to System 6. You should use the Communications Toolbox if you have a text/menu account.To connect over PPP, see the PPP instructions (you do not need to come back to these instructions). You should use MacTCP if you have a PPP account or if you have any other direct connection to the network.Now, did you select MacTCP or Communications Toolbox?
